Reflection and refraction are both phenomena that occur when light rays encounter a boundary or interface between two different substances or mediums.

Reflection:
Reflection is the bouncing back of light rays when they hit a surface, such as a mirror or any other smooth and polished surface. The angle of incidence (the angle between the incident ray and the normal to the surface) is equal to the angle of reflection (the angle between the reflected ray and the normal). Reflection takes place without any change in the frequency or wavelength of light.

Refraction:
Refraction is the bending or change in direction of light rays when they pass from one medium to another, such as from air to glass or from water to air. The amount of bending depends on the change in speed of light as it moves from one medium to another. This change in speed of light is due to the difference in the refractive indices of the two mediums.
